In pea plants, yellow seed color is dominant and green seed color is recessive. What will the generations look like? Assume that

Mendel’s method of crossing two true breeding parents with opposite traits is followed. Check all that apply.
The P generation has all yellow seeds.

The P generation has all green seeds.

The P generation has yellow and green seeds.

The F1 generation has yellow and green seeds.

The F1 generation has all yellow seeds.

The F2 generation has all green seeds.

The F2 generation has yellow and green seeds.

Answer:

The correct statements are:

  • The P generation has yellow and green seeds.  
  • The F1 generation has all yellow seeds.  
  • The F2 generation has yellow and green seeds.

The given cross is the monohybrid cross between the plant with yellow seeds and plant with green seed.

Thus, the parent generation contains both yellow and green seed plants.

Let Y and y  be the alleles of the gene responsible for seed color. Y is the dominant trait which codes for yellow color and y is the recessive allele which codes for green color.

The genotype of one parent is YY and that of another would be yy.

The cross would produce the offspring with genotype Yy. Thus, all the offspring would have yellow color seeds as yellow is the dominant trait.

On selfing F₁ generation, the offspring would produce with three types of genotypes YY, Yy, and yy in the ratio 1:2:1.

Thus, F₂ generation would contain yellow and green seeds in 3:1.

a 24 kg rock containing 3,528 j of potential energy rests upon the edge of a cliff how tall is the cliff
GenaCL600 [577]
Potential gravitational energy is computed with the formula:

PEgrav=mgh

Where:
PEgrav = Potential gravitation energy (J)
m = mass (kg)
h = height (m)
g = acceleration due to gravity (9.8m/s^2) 

Take note that acceleration due to gravity is a constant. 

All you need to do is put in what you know and solve for what you don't know. So your given is the following:
PEgrav = 3,528J
m = 24 kg
g = 9.8 m/s^2
Put that into your formula:
PEgrav=mgh
3,528J = (24kg)(9.8m/s^{2})(h)
3,528J = (235.2kg.m/s^{2})(h)
\frac{3,528J}{235.2kg.m/s^{2}} = h
15m=h

The height of the cliff is 15m.
